The Financial Case for Coming to Cuenca<\/h2>\n<p>One of the strongest reasons people travel to Cuenca for dental care is the cost. Typical prices in the United States and Canada for a single dental implant with abutment and crown commonly range from $3,000 to $6,000 or more. In Cuenca, comparable treatment often costs 60\u201370% less, which means many patients pay in the $1,000\u2013$2,500 range for an implant including the crown. Similarly, a porcelain crown that might cost $800\u2013$1,500 in North America often runs $200\u2013$450 in Cuenca. Veneers can also be 60\u201370% cheaper.<\/p>\n<p>Those savings are not marginal \u2014 they change what is possible. A full-arch reconstruction or multiple implants that would cost tens of thousands at home can become affordable in Cuenca without sacrificing quality. For many people this transforms long-delayed dental plans into realistic options.<\/p>\n<h2>World-Class Training and Clinical Expertise<\/h2>\n<p>Cost savings in Cuenca do not come from cutting corners on education or skill. That continuity fosters trust and often produces better outcomes.<\/p>\n<h2>How to Plan Your Dental Trip: Practical Tips and Itineraries<\/h2>\n<p>Planning is the key to a smooth dental vacation. Here\u2019s a practical guide to help you prepare: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Start with a virtual consultation:<\/strong> Many Cuenca clinics offer video consultations. Send recent x-rays or scans and get a preliminary treatment plan and quote before you travel.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Bring your dental history:<\/strong> Copies of current X-rays, a list of medications, and past dental records speed up diagnosis and reduce duplicate imaging costs.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Book a slightly flexible schedule:<\/strong> A single implant can require multiple visits over weeks; expect at least two to three visits if implant placement and final crown delivery are involved. Many patients plan two trips or a single 10\u201314 day stay for complex cases.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Sample 7\u201310 day itinerary for a single implant and crown:<\/strong> Day 1: Arrival and consultation; Day 2: Implant surgery; Days 3\u20136: Rest, light sightseeing; Days 7\u201310: Follow-up and impressions for crown (if same-day crown is offered, the timeline may be shorter).<\/li>\n<li><strong>Sample 10\u201314 day itinerary for multiple implants:<\/strong> Includes staged surgeries, healing days, and final prosthetic fittings. Your dentist will tailor the plan according to bone grafts or sinus lifts if needed.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Accommodations:<\/strong> Choose convenient lodging near the Historic Center (El Centro) or neighborhoods like Turi for quiet hillside views. Short-term rentals and boutique hotels are plentiful and affordable.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Safety, Language and Practicalities<\/h2>\n<p>Cuenca is known for being safe and expat-friendly.
